Job Description - Project Engineer (Repairs & Maintenance)

Job Purpose

The Project / Repair / Maintenance Engineer is responsible for planning, coordinating, and executing vessel repair, maintenance, upgrading, and engineering projects. The role ensures that work is completed safely, on schedule, within budget, and in accordance with quality standards, regulatory requirements, and customer expectations.

Key Responsibilities

Project Planning & Execution

  • Plan, coordinate, and supervise repair, maintenance, retrofit, and upgrading activities for vessels and marine systems.
  • Review technical specifications, drawings, work scopes, and customer requirements.
  • Monitor project progress and ensure project milestones are achieved according to schedule.
  • Coordinate manpower, materials, equipment, subcontractors, and vendors to support project execution.
  • Prepare work plans, inspection schedules, and project reports.

Technical Support & Engineering

  • Provide technical support during project execution, troubleshooting, and defect rectification.
  • Conduct site inspections and assess vessel conditions to determine repair or maintenance requirements.
  • Support root-cause analysis and recommend corrective and preventive actions.
  • Ensure engineering solutions comply with applicable classification, statutory, and company requirements.
  • Review engineering documentation and maintain accurate project records.

Maintenance & Repair Management

  • Coordinate preventive, corrective, and breakdown maintenance activities.
  • Monitor repair quality and ensure work is completed according to specifications and standards.
  • Manage testing, commissioning, and handover activities upon project completion.
  • Track maintenance history and recommend improvements to enhance reliability and operational performance.

Quality, Safety & Compliance

  • Ensure compliance with Workplace Safety and Health (WSH) requirements, company policies, and industry regulations.
  • Participate in risk assessments, toolbox meetings, safety inspections, and incident investigations as required.
  • Ensure quality control procedures and inspection requirements are followed throughout project execution.
  • Support continuous improvement initiatives to enhance safety, productivity, and work quality.

Stakeholder Coordination

  • Liaise with customers, classification societies, vendors, subcontractors, and internal departments.
  • Attend project meetings and provide updates on project status, risks, and resource requirements.
  • Build positive working relationships with stakeholders to support successful project delivery.

Requirements

Education

  • Diploma or Degree in Mechanical Engineering, Marine Engineering, Electrical Engineering, Naval Architecture, or a related engineering discipline.

Experience

  • Experience in vessel repair, maintenance, shipbuilding, marine engineering, or related industries preferred.
  • Experience managing repair, maintenance, retrofit, or engineering projects is an advantage.
  • Fresh graduates with relevant marine or engineering exposure may be considered for junior positions.

Technical Competencies

  • Ability to interpret engineering drawings, technical specifications, and maintenance documentation.
  • Knowledge of marine systems, machinery, equipment, and maintenance practices.
  • Familiarity with project planning and coordination.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office applications; knowledge of project management software is an advantage.
